#98070e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#98070e is composed of 59.6% red, 2.7% green and 5.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 95.4% magenta, 90.8% yellow and 40.4% black. It has a hue angle of 357.1 degrees, a saturation of 91.2% and a lightness of 31.2%. #98070e color hex could be obtained by blending #ff0e1c with #310000. Closest websafe color is: #990000.

#98070e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#98070e has RGB values of R:152, G:7, B:14 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.95, Y:0.91, K:0.4. Its decimal value is 9963278.

Shades and Tints of #98070e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020000 is the darkest color, while #feeeef is the lightest one.

Tones of #98070e
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#554a4b is the less saturated color, while #9e0108 is the most saturated one.
